Fujitsu's managed services to cover IT infrastructure of the city of Espoo
Helsinki, 2nd April 2008 — Fujitsu Services Oy assumes the overall responsibility for the IT infrastructure services of the city of Espoo, the second largest city in Finland. The renewed agreement covers the IT infrastructure services for all the desktops of Espoo city employees, thus incorporating all in all some 10,000 workstations.
The agreement is worth approximately 18,5 million euros and spans over a period of four years. The sum comprises also the costs of a year-long deployment project.
Fujitsu's services will reach all of Espoo's around 500 offices and more than 14,000 employees of the city. Fujitsu's maintenance service will also cover application, infrastructure and local area network services.

About Espoo
Espoo is the second largest city in Finland with population of more than 238,000, which increases by 3,000 - 4,000 people each year. Marketta Kokkonen is city mayor. The city of Espoo employs some 14,000 people. This year the City of Espoo will celebrate its 550th anniversary.
